Indian Mines Calcium Carbonate Specification

  • Solubility
  • Slightly soluble in water
  • Ph Level
  • 9 (in water suspension)
  • Shape
  • Powder
  • EINECS No
  • 207-439-9
  • Storage
  • Store in a cool, dry place, away from moisture
  • Poisonous
  • Non-poisonous
  • Taste
  • Odourless and tasteless
  • Melting Point
  • 825C (decomposes)
  • Usage
  • Filler, extender, and additive
  • Purity
  • 99% approx.
  • HS Code
  • 28365000
  • Smell
  • Odourless
  • Appearance
  • White fine powder
  • Structural Formula
  • O=C([O-])[O-].[Ca+2]
  • Molecular Formula
  • CaCO3
  • Refractive Rate
  • 1.59
  • Shelf Life
  • Stable under recommended storage conditions
  • Properties
  • Insoluble in water, high brightness, neutral pH, fine particle size
  • Product Type
  • Minerals
  • CAS No
  • 471-34-1
  • Ingredients
  • Calcium Carbonate (CaCO3)
  • Physical Form
  • Powder
  • Application
  • Used in plastic, rubber, paint, paper, and construction industries
  • Molecular Weight
  • 100.09 g/mol
  • Grade
  • Industrial Grade
  • Density
  • 2.7 Gram per cubic centimeter(g/cm3)
  • Moisture Content
  • 0.2% max
  • Safety
  • Generally recognized as safe (GRAS) when used as directed
  • pH range (10% solution)
  • 8.5 - 9.5
  • Loss on Ignition (LOI)
  • 43-44%
  • Whiteness
  • 90% min
  • Oil Absorption
  • 24-28 ml/100g
  • Mesh Size
  • 200-500 mesh
  • Bulk Density
  • 0.8-1.1 g/cm3
